Woman, 47, charged over Covent Garden stabbings

Thursday, 6 August 2026 13:33

A 47-year-old woman has been charged over the stabbings in London's Covent Garden on Wednesday that left four men injured.

Stella Gollovena is charged with four counts of wounding with intent to cause grievous bodily harm and one count of possession of an offensive weapon in a public place.

She was remanded in custody to appear at Highbury Magistrates' Court on Thursday afternoon.

The charges comes after police were called to reports of a stabbing on Endell Street, Covent Garden, at around 12.30 on Wednesday.

Four men - aged 34, 39, 42 and 56 - were found with stab wounds and taken to hospital.

Their injuries were neither life-threatening nor life-changing, and they have since been discharged.

An air ambulance helicopter landed in Trafalgar Square as part of the response.
